Most Popular Reply

Agree. Less interviews with mega-investors 1000+ units, coaches, mentors. More "average" investors like me that have purchased and sold, own 20, 30, 40+ units and looking to scale to 200-400. Real deal examples from sourcing to closing and deal structuring to make these crazy prices work, not just success stories but the mistakes or bad deals as well. Too many success stories out there and there is no shame in the bad ones, but I suppose people (syndicators/coaches/mentors) don't prefer to expose their reps to that but there are valuable lessons to be learned. Maybe I'm off and that people listed because they want to constantly want to be inspired. I like to relate now and then to investors on my own level. I can't relate to (nor do I inspire to be) an investor or group that owns 6000 units with a team of 12 underwriters, etc. I should add...don't need a lot of REI 101, either. I'd like more mid-level experience stuff. I've overdosed on high level, inspirational, motivational stuff.
